    Need help with a tree view component

    I am trying to set up tree view navigatin in one of my
    projects. Does any one have a sample to look at.

    Really need to see what you're after,, but basically start with the root folder and expand the tree from there using "key Frames",, Frame 2(cos frame 1 is a bad place to put a "stop movie" command) = the root. Frame three = the expanded root and from there you take your individual branches and assign them a frame number. it'll take a bit of time but very few resources to make it,, I'll try and do an example later on if I have time but I'm sure that someone has something done already.
